Guedes Soares, C. (1992), “Combination of Primary Load Effects in Ship Structures”, Probabilistic Engineering Mechanics, Vol. 7, pp. 103-111

The models currently used for representing the still-water and the wave-induced load effects in ship structures are discussed. Models based both on random variables and on stochastic processess are considered. Load combination solutions are obtained based on the Ferry Borges-Castanheta model for random variables and also on an upcrossing formulation for stochastic processes. Load combination factors appropriate for code purposes are suggested and their values are derived from comparison with the load combination results.
